The nose is fruity, fresh and elegant, racy and offers good definition and depth. It reveals notes of quite ripe wild raspberry, small ripe wild red berries andsmall notes of violet associated with touches of concentrated cassis, tobacco, as well as fine hints of balsamic and discreet hints of toastiness and roasting. The palate is fruity and offers minerality, a certain freshness, energy, a good definition and melodious side. In mouth this wine expresses notes of concentrated blackberry, crushed raspberry andsmall notes of violet associated with touches of small roasted-elegant red berries, as well as hints of sage, olive tree and tapenade. Good length. Mellow tannins. A hint of tonka bean and roasted almond in the background.
